What is the R&D tax credit?

The R&D Tax Credit is a valuable tool for businesses committed to innovation and growth. By offsetting the costs of research and development, the credit not only benefits individual companies but also contributes to the advancement of technology and industry as a whole. While claiming the credit requires careful planning and documentation, the potential rewards make it well worth the effort. For businesses looking to stay competitive and drive progress, the R&D Tax Credit is an opportunity to turn innovation into tangible financial benefits.
